Fri, 12 December 2008 It's Christmas Eve, 1876. The shipbuilding industry isn't what it once was in Greenmanville, so the town is putting on a benefit production. They couldn't have chosen a better show, Charles Dickens' A Christmas Carol. But things are not going as planned. Tonight, one prominent businessman must face the choices of his past. Lantern Light Tours are scheduled primarily Thursday through Sunday evenings. Each tour is an hour long moving performance and is not recommended for children under four. Reservations are strongly recommended, particularly for Friday and Saturday performances. Tours begin at 5 p.m. and leave every 15 minutes. Handicapped accessible tours are available each evening.
